To avoid useless electric power consumption by generating stopping maintaining braking force by a braking force generating means instead of demand braking force when the demand braking force according to a brake pedaling quantity is larger than the stopping maintaining braking force required for maintaining a stopping state in the stopping state.
This motor-driven brake device is provided with a pedaling force sensor 11 for detecting pedaling force of brake a vehicle speed sensor 12 for detecting a vehicle speed, an inclination sensor 13 for detecting an inclination of a vehicle and a vehicle weight sensor 14 for detecting vehicle weight to output detecting signals of the sensors to a controller 20. At stopping time, a stopping maintaining motor current capable of generating a braking force required for maintaining a vehicle in a stopping state is detected, and when the stopping maintaining motor current is smaller than a motor current capable of the generating braking force based on a pedaling quantity of the brake motors 5FL to 5RR are driven according to the stopping maintaining motor current. Thus, electric power consumption can be reduced while maintaining the stopping state.
